About 2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ide
2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ide (PubChem CID 78831193) has the molecular formula C19H17F2N3OS
and a molecular weight of 373.43 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ide.

What is the SMILES notation for 2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ide?
The canonical SMILES for 2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ide is CC(Sc1nc2c(cc1C#N)CCCC2)C(=O)Nc1ccc(F)c(F)c1.
What is the InChIKey of 2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ide?
The InChIKey is UMCXQFIJGJVCKU-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C19H17F2N3OS/c1-11(18(25)23-14-6-7-15(20)16(21)9-14)26-19-13(10-22)8-12-4-2-3-5-17(12)24-19/h6-9,11H,2-5H2,1H3,(H,23,25).
What are the key properties of 2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ide?
2-[(3-cyano-5,6,7,8-tetrahydroquinolin-2-yl)sulfanyl]-N-(3,4-difluorophenyl)propanamide has a molecular weight of 373.43 g/mol, XLogP of 4.23, 4 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
